STONINGTON, CT — The body of a missing woman was found in the Pawcatuck River Thursday, according to WTNH. The Pawcatuck Fire Department found the body of Evelina Gaccione, 76, on the Stonington side of the river.

She had been reported missing Tuesday and a Silver Alert had been issued by State Police.

The search for Gaccione started Wednesday after she had been missing for 24 hours, The Westerly Sun reported. After the search was called off due to darkness, firefighters from Westerly, Pawcatuck, and North Stonington resumed the search Thursday with both land- and water-based teams.

The case remains under investigation.
